Duplex Penthouse in Monte Halcones, Benahavis
Monte Halcones 3F
A two-bedroom, two-bathroom duplex penthouse in Monte Halcones, arranged over two levels with an entrance floor hosting an open-plan kitchen, dining and living area with a home office, guest bedroom and terrace, and an upper level dedicated to the master suite with walk-in wardrobe and a second terrace with private pool, all set against panoramic mountain, golf and sea views.
